Output 62e24cafbaad1646079c5552d942ddbdc1e177d28688493295fad84d92fd5e1d:2

value
95000
script pubkey
OP_0 OP_PUSHBYTES_20 5059c3a2a4f1ba15ed92f5b1e8b4b571705e3f44
address
bc1q2pvu8g4y7xaptmvj7kc73d94w9c9u06ygwlgwm
transaction
62e24cafbaad1646079c5552d942ddbdc1e177d28688493295fad84d92fd5e1d
confirmations
122743
spent
true